Transaction 2b7fefd6cf4e4a14e5adb7ccc80c329118a7f41cfe9212ffcc2baef9a0456ff0

21 Input
1 Outputs
  • 2b7fefd6cf4e4a14e5adb7ccc80c329118a7f41cfe9212ffcc2baef9a0456ff0:0
  • value  19187938
    address  3AFzjnBmVZvgv1kVCDjpBF3YowEYSVt8ch